art workshop insurance is designed to cover a wide range of potential risks and liabilities that may arise during art workshops. These policies typically include general liability coverage, property insurance, and additional coverage specific to the art workshop industry. General liability coverage protects against claims of bodily injury or property damage resulting from accidents that occur during the workshop. This can include slips and falls, damage to artwork, or injuries caused by art materials or equipment.
Property insurance is another significant aspect of art workshop insurance. Art workshops often house expensive equipment, tools, and materials that are essential for artistic creation. Fire, theft, or natural disasters can lead to significant financial losses if these items are not adequately insured. Property insurance can help replace or repair damaged property, ensuring that artists can continue their work without facing crippling financial burdens.
Additionally, art workshop insurance can offer specialized coverage that addresses the unique risks associated with this industry. For example, art workshop organizers may need coverage for cancellation or postponement of events due to unforeseen circumstances such as illness, extreme weather conditions, or venue issues. This coverage can help protect against any financial loss incurred by canceling or rescheduling workshops, including fees paid by participants or rental costs.
Furthermore, art workshop insurance may offer coverage for the transportation of artwork to and from workshops, protecting against damage or loss during transit. This is especially crucial for artists who rely on shipping companies or courier services to transport their artwork, as accidents or mishandling can result in irreplaceable damage.
